Target Exclusivity definition

Target Exclusivity means the exclusive rights with respect to each Target granted to Pfizer by Arvinas pursuant to Section 2.10.
Target Exclusivity means that, with respect to a Poseida Selected Target, TeneoBio and its Affiliates shall not license to a Third Party, or, on its own or through Third Parties, research (other than immunization services against unknown targets as and to the extent permitted in Section 5.4), develop, commercialize, or sell an antibody or other protein or peptide directed to such Poseida Selected Target for use in a cell therapy product containing a cell expressing a chimeric antigen receptor including such antibody or other protein or peptide.

More Definitions of Target Exclusivity

Target Exclusivity means Schrödinger shall not design, research, develop, or commercialize compounds or conduct virtual screens of compounds that directly and primarily inhibit the Target, whether on its or its’ Affiliates’ own behalf or on behalf of any Third Party. For clarity, the foregoing exclusivity obligation shall not apply to the following services and activities: (a) [***], (b) [***], (c) [***], (d) [***] (e) and (f) [***].
